The South Gate of Bath c.1650

The South Gate of Bath c.1650

Image Reference: 18203
Artist/Photographer: Lewis, William
Image Date: 1650
Measurements: 12.2 x 18.8 cm
Medium: print
Collection: Loose Prints
Library Reference: R1 / 432
Images of Bath ref.: 972
Credit: Bath & North East Somerset Council
Library: Bath & North East Somerset Council

Description: An artist's impression of how the medieval entrance gates to the city might have looked. Originally published as a postcard.
From "Bath Before Beau Nash" by Meg Hamilton, 1978. W. Lewis, Lith. Proceedings of Natural History Club, 1879, Vol. 4, No. 2.
